Medical Screenings for Newborns: Know Your Options

Most parents would embrace the opportunity to test their newborn for a life-threatening disease, especially if early detection meant avoiding serious health problems. Expanded newborn screening is a test that surprisingly few parents have heard about and few pediatricians use. But for approximately $25.00, your baby can be screened for 30 inherited conditions, all of which are treatable if caught early in life.

Immunization Guidelines for Children

The Parents' Health Guide A vaccine, or immunization, is a medication given to a person so that he or she produces antibodies against a certain infection. These antibodies then serve to help prevent the infection.
